GENERAL DESCRIPTION:
Ensures the food service provided for the community meets and/or exceeds company standards while maintaining compliance with HACCP, OSHA, and local, state and federal regulations.
PRIMARY D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Plans weekly menus in accordance with the community policies and procedures, and incorporates a variety of nutritional foods and foods in season
- Maintains an adequate inventory of foods and supplies from approved vendors, staying within budget
- Continually looks for ways to improve and/or enhance the quality of foods and services provided
- Prepares and cooks food in accordance with nutritional guidelines, regulations, and residents’ individual food preferences; accommodates modified diets to the extent allowed by the community’s license
- Ensures that food is served in an appetizing and appealing manner
- Assists nursing and caregiving staff in fostering residents’ independence with eating by taking the time to know the residents and providing/recommending adaptive equipment when needed
- Ensures that food and beverage delivered to activity areas and resident apartments arrives on schedule at proper temperatures
- Visits with the residents at each meal (and/or has other supervisory staff do so) to continually assess quality. Addresses concerns immediately or follows-up
- Plans and provides refreshments/meals for special events; works collaboratively with other departments to ensure success
- Provides a forum for resident input and suggestions
- Maintains a clean, organized and safe kitchen environment
- Ensures proper storage and handling of food in accordance with infection control standards
- Recruits and hires dining services employees
- Ensures that all community employees who handle and deliver food and beverage are trained in proper food handling; trains dining service staff in emergency procedures pertaining to kitchen, dining areas and any areas where food may be served
- Schedules staff to meet the needs of the department, staying within budget
- Ensures that all food staff abide by sanitation and safety regulations and perform their duties as required and expected
- Conducts regular performance appraisals with employees
- Follows procedure in responding to on-the-job injuries
- Performs Manager on Duty responsibilities when assigned
- Encourages teamwork and promotes company philosophy
- Attends required community meetings and trainings
- Becomes familiar with and understands emergency response procedures for entire community, up to and including evacuation
- Responsible for maintaining a safe and secure dining environment for employee and community residents
- Performs other duties as assigned
